Why 16 Inch Stainless Steel Tongs Are Necessary
I find 16 inch stainless steel tongs necessary because they give me the right amount of reach and control when I’m handling hot food. Whether I’m grilling, frying, or serving, the extra length helps keep my hands safely away from heat, oil splatter, and flames. That makes cooking feel much safer and more comfortable for me.
I also like that stainless steel tongs are strong, durable, and easy to clean. In my experience, they don’t bend easily, and they hold up well even with regular use. Since stainless steel is resistant to rust and stains, I can rely on them for a long time without worrying much about wear and tear.
For me, the 16 inch size is especially useful when I’m cooking larger meals or working over a hot grill. It gives me better grip and more confidence while turning meat, vegetables, or other foods. That combination of safety, strength, and convenience is why I consider them an essential kitchen tool.

What I Look for in Material Quality
I always check the quality of the stainless steel first. I prefer rust-resistant stainless steel because it holds up better over time, especially if I use the tongs often or wash them frequently. A solid build matters to me because flimsy tongs can bend, weaken, or lose grip.
Why Length Matters to Me
The 16 inch length is one of the main reasons I choose these tongs. I find this size especially useful for grilling, frying, and handling hot foods from a safe distance. In my experience, shorter tongs can put my hands too close to heat, while 16 inch tongs give me better safety and comfort.
Grip and Control Are Important
I always test how well the tongs grip food. I prefer tongs with a firm, responsive tip that can pick up items without slipping. If the handle feels awkward or the grip is too stiff, I know it will be frustrating to use. For me, the best tongs feel balanced and easy to control.
Handle Comfort I Consider
Comfort is another thing I pay attention to. I like tongs with a handle that feels secure in my hand, especially when I’m cooking for a long time. If the handle has a non-slip design or a smooth finish that still feels stable, that is a big plus for me.
Locking Mechanism I Prefer
I find a locking mechanism very helpful for storage. When my tongs can lock closed, they take up less space in my drawer or hang neatly on a hook. I usually look for a lock that is simple to use and doesn’t jam, because convenience matters to me.
Heat Resistance and Safety
Since I often use tongs near grills, pans, and ovens, I make sure they can handle high heat. Stainless steel tongs usually perform well in this area, and I appreciate that they do not melt like some plastic tools. Safety is always a priority for me, so I choose tongs that stay sturdy under heat.
Easy Cleaning Is a Must for Me
I like tools that are easy to maintain, and stainless steel tongs usually fit that need. I prefer models that are dishwasher safe or simple to rinse clean by hand. If food gets stuck in the hinge or tips, I know cleaning will become annoying, so I look for a design that is easy to wash thoroughly.
